Linda J. Hosmer, 74, a resident of Maple Court Homes, passed away Sunday (May 14, 2023 at St. James Hospital.
Born in North Hornell, April 9, 1949, she was the daughter of Ben F. and Jean Hurlburt and had resided most all her life in Hornell. Linda was employed in the Cafeteria at the Hornell High School. She enjoyed music, knitting and crocheting.
Linda was a woman of strong faith which she practiced throughout her life.
She was predeceased by her parents, her husband, Eugene Hosmer, her sister Susan McDaniels, and her brother, David Hurlburt,
Surviving are four sons, Bernard (Denise) Hults, Roger (Samantha Allen ) Hults, Benjamin (Beth) Hults, and Brett Hults all of Hornell. Her sisters, Kathleen (Martin) Eddy of Alfred Station, Christine Hassig Rowe of Livonia and Debra (Rodney) Finney of Bath, her brother Stephen (Sue) Hurlburt of Hornell, Four grandchildren, Tyler Hults, Collin Hults, Kaitlyn Hults and Teal Hults, great grand daughter, Scarlette Jackson, many nieces, nephews, and cousins.
